Description
Weed, son of Gin and Sakura, is born in the Japanese Alps alongside siblings Yukimura and Joe. He later becomes father to Sirius, Orion, Rigel, and Bellatrix. Following Sakura's early death from illness, the English Setter GB names him "Weed" to embody "small but powerful," pledging to reunite him with Gin in the Ōu Mountains. This journey defines his initial background through parental loss and displacement.
He possesses blue and white fur and blue eyes, closely resembling Gin. Weed inherits natural combat abilities, including the capacity to instinctively perform the Zetsu Tenrou Battouga—a specialized technique mastered by Gin and Riki. This skill first emerges when he saves GB and Sasuke from a guard dog, severing the aggressor's ear in an early confrontation. His appearance and fighting prowess immediately signal his heroic lineage.
Weed's personality is marked by profound kindness, unwavering loyalty, and a strict moral code centered on mercy. He consistently attempts to save or redeem adversaries, such as rescuing the villainous Blue from a truck collision and refusing to kill the defeated Hougen despite his atrocities. This ethos sparks conflicts, notably his banishment of Jerome for executing defenseless foes (Thunder and Lector), which Weed condemns as violating his "Thou Shalt Not Kill" principle. Allies like Kyōshirō criticize his stance as naive or "Stupid Good," arguing wartime necessitates lethal force. Yet, Weed remains resolute, prioritizing compassion even at the risk of isolation.
His development unfolds across major conflicts. In the Kaibutsu (Monster) arc, Weed witnesses allies Tokimune (Gin's substitute) and Smith die confronting the mutated dog P4. He defeats P4 by knocking it off a cliff, impaling it on a branch. During the Hougen arc, he rallies over 100 dogs to rescue the hostage Gin. After Hougen nearly kills him in a brutal battle, Weed is revitalized by spirits of fallen Ōu soldiers and defeats Hougen with the Battouga, sparing his life. Gin then formally designates Weed as Ōu's new leader.
Later arcs test Weed's leadership against escalating threats. He confronts Victor, a German shepherd invading Hokkaidō, aiding Jerome and Victor's defectors to thwart the takeover. When a hybrid bear kills Joe's mate Hitomi, GB sacrifices himself to save Weed. Weed avenges GB by battling the bear into a river, where it dies striking a floodgate. Surviving, Weed returns to Ōu and reunites with mate Koyuki, who later bears their four pups. Subsequent challenges include confronting the bear Monsoon in *Ginga: The Last Wars* (set six months after *Ginga Densetsu Weed: Orion*), as Monsoon attacks Futago Pass to avenge his father Akakabuto. Weed sustains severe injuries from one of Monsoon's kin.
Weed embodies themes of inherited responsibility and idealism. His refusal to abandon mercy, even towards irredeemable foes, cements his identity distinct from Gin's legacy, while his growth from a grieving pup to a resilient leader underscores his narrative trajectory.
